The Intelligence Production Solutions Division (IPSD), part of the Decision Advantage Solutions Business Area, is currently seeking a highly motivated Junior Software Engineer for the Chinook Program. The Chinook Program delivers next-generation, mission-focused software solutions for geospatial intelligence (GEOINT). This role offers a unique opportunity to contribute to meaningful national security work while building experience with modern software tools, agile practices, and classified cloud environments.
As a Junior Software Engineer, you will work as part of an agile development team to help design, implement, test, and deploy applications and services. You will receive mentorship from senior engineers while supporting the development of systems that enhance our customer's data access, visualization, and dissemination capabilities.

Primary Responsibilities:
- Engage in the complete software development lifecycle, operating within well-defined parameters.
- Take ownership of delivering enhancements within a system or application.
- Break down sizable tasks into manageable units for execution and provide LOE estimations.
- Collaborate with fellow software engineers to create and document optimal technical designs.
- Ensure team compliance with Agile processes and best practices.
- Build software solutions where the solution is not clearly defined but always prioritizing customer needs.
Basic Qualifications:
- ship is required per contract.
-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ering is required with less than 2 years of prior relevant experience.
- Hands-on experience with the following technologies:
- Web: HTML, CSS, Django, and REST APIs
- Object-oriented Programming: Python, Java, JavaScript, and REACT
- Relational Database: PostgreSQL with the ability to write SQL statements
- Operating System: Windows, Linux
- Version Control System: Git
- Understanding of modern software design patterns and coding standards.
- Strong, self-motivated desire to learn new programming languages, tools, frameworks, and techniques.
- Ability to complete tasking independently with minimal direct supervision.
- Ability to work and collaborate effectively within a multi-disciplined engineering team.
Preferred Qualifications:
- Software Architectures: Client-Server, Microservices, Model-View-Controller.
- Cloud Exposure:
- Multi-cloud architectures: AWS, IBM, Google, Azure, and Oracle.
- Specific AWS Services: S3, SQS, SNS, EC2, CloudFormation and RDS.
- Working knowledge of Agile development and continuous integration/continuous delivery methodologies and tools.
- Knowledge of continuous integration and delivery tools: Jenkins, GitLab, and Docker.
- Demonstrated experience planning and presenting user interface designs.
